会员
周边
新闻
博问
闪存
众包
赞助商
YouClaw
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
阶梯
博客园
首页
新随笔
联系
管理
订阅
04 2011 档案
常用模型
摘要:#waxian velocityfrom rsf.proj import *import mathpar = { 'nz':400, 'dz':2.0, 'oz':0, 'nx':400, 'dx':10.0, 'ox':0 } def reflector(formula,par): return ''' math n1=%d o1=%g d1=%g n2=1 output="%s" ''' % (par['nx'
阅读全文
posted @
2011-04-11 08:46
June-X
阅读(398)
评论(0)
推荐(0)
来个层状模型
摘要:from rsf.proj import *Flow('v',None, ''' spike mag=1.0,2.0 nsp=2 n1=800 n2=1000 d1=1 d2=1 o1=0 o2=0 p2=0.2,0.2 k1=200,500 l1=499,800| add add=2.0 ''')Flow('v0',None, ''' spike mag=1.0 nsp=1 n1=200 n2=1000 d1=1 d2=1 o1=0 o1=0 ''')Flow(
阅读全文
posted @
2011-04-10 10:33
June-X
阅读(404)
评论(0)
推荐(0)
在一个SConstruct文件中使用SU与Madagarscar命令
摘要:同一段包含su与mada命令的代码两种实现方式(不同部分粗体标注了一下)方法1.from rsf.proj import *os.system("suplane>plane.su")os.system("segyhdrs<plane.su |segywrite tape=plane.segy")Flow('plane tfile hfile bfile','plane.segy','segyread endian=1 tfile=${TARGETS[1]} hfile=${TARGETS[2]} bfi
阅读全文
posted @
2011-04-05 11:06
June-X
阅读(831)
评论(0)
推荐(0)
程序为什么不执行?
摘要:写完一堆Flow,在命令行scons,结果程序根本没有执行赶快为你的输出文件补上Result,或者在命令行输入scons xx.rsf (xx是Flow的输出文件名)不过还有一个办法,文件头改成from rsf.proj import Flow
阅读全文
posted @
2011-04-01 23:08
June-X
阅读(222)
评论(0)
推荐(0)
帮助将要学习scons/Madagascar的新同学们
摘要:来自邮件列表的一封呼吁贴,为迅速抓住主题,翻译如下:亲爱滴同学们: 还记得自己刚刚使用Madagascar时纠结痛苦无助的惨痛经历乎? 你可以参与编辑文档,来帮助如当年的自己一样弱小的新Madaer,特别特别需要的是,请帮助偶们编辑SCons文档页: http://www.ahay.org/wiki/SCons 您只需两步走: 1.点击页面右上角的"login/create account"链接 2.遵循mediawiki语句(http://meta.wikimedia.org/wiki/Help:Editing)编辑页面 如果文档中还有什么漏洞,请帮助指明并补充,与其闲的
阅读全文
posted @
2011-04-01 22:10
June-X
阅读(361)
评论(0)
推荐(0)
在SContruct中编译.c
摘要:Program('AFDM.x',['AFDM.c','fdutil.c','omputil.c'])Flow(['da','wa'],['wava','vp','ro','ss','rr','AFDM.x'], ''' ./AFDM.x ompchunk=%(ompchunk)d ompnth=%(ompnth)d verb=y free=n snap=%(snap)s jsna
阅读全文
posted @
2011-04-01 10:49
June-X
阅读(191)
评论(0)
推荐(0)
公告